A large meta-analysis from March 2021 found that rapid antigen tests detected about 72% of symptomatic cases confirmed positive by a PCR test. The requirements come after 55 passengers who traveled on Emirates flights from Pakistan in June later tested positive for coronavirus. "By using a 1-day window, test acceptability does not depend on the time of the flight or the time of day that the test sample was taken," the agency says.
